About the Role

We are seeking a motivated and skilled individual to join our team as an Apprentice Carpenter. As a key member of our construction team, you will assist in the completion of residential construction and renovation projects.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in the safe demolition of existing structures and the renovation and extension of current structures.
  • Work safely on busy building sites alongside other trade persons.
  • Utilize power tools safely and in accordance with WHS policies and procedures.
Requirements
  • VET Construction qualification.
  • Previous work experience in a related field.
  • Current driver's license and reliable vehicle.
  • White Card.
  • Ability to pass a pre-employment medical, including drug and alcohol testing.
  • Current Working with Vulnerable People Card and National Police Check (or ability to obtain).
What We Offer
  • National Training Wage.
  • Opportunity to gain a nationally recognized Certificate III in Carpentry (CPC30220).
  • Training and mentoring from experienced professionals.
